Yesterday, 11/20/2018, another important step for the legalization of sports betting in Brazil was overcome with the approval of the report of Provisional Measure 846/2018 by the Plenary of the Chamber of Deputies.

The next step is now the Senate Plenary vote, which we believe may occur later this week, possibly without major difficulties for approval.

We would also like to remind you that sports betting had already been approved at the time of Provisional Measure 671/2015 - The LOTEX Instant Lottery PM. At the time, then-President Dilma Rousseff vetoed parts of the text that legalized sports betting, continuing only provisions on Instant Lotteries. We believe that a presidential veto should not be repeated, given that there was great support from the Congressmen of the current legislature and also from members of the new elected government, which will take office in January 2019.

Even after it is approved, there will also be a need for the Ministry of Finance, through SEFEL, to decide how to start the operation of sports betting in Brazil. It can be seen that the models that can be adopted are three:

1) A model similar to LOTEX with a single concession for a single operator;

2) The transfer of the operation to Caixa;

3) The adoption of a model of multiple licenses by complying with certain requirements, whether limited to a certain number or not.

Option 3 seems to us to be the model more in line with what the new elected government stands for, following a more liberal and free market and competition incentive line.
